The Zirconia Fiber market is witnessing substantial growth due to its advanced insulation properties and high thermal stability. Zirconia, a ceramic material known for its high melting point and resistance to thermal shock, is increasingly used in various industrial applications. The key market segments based on application include General Insulation and Zirconia Fiber Products. This report provides a detailed description of these segments, exploring their role and expanding influence in industries such as manufacturing, aerospace, and energy.
The General Insulation subsegment within the Zirconia Fiber market focuses on applications where high thermal resistance and stability are crucial. Zirconia fiber is used extensively for insulating high-temperature industrial environments, such as furnaces, kilns, and reactors. These fibers offer excellent heat resistance, withstanding temperatures up to 1,800°C, which is significantly higher than traditional insulation materials. As a result, they are employed in industries like steel production, glass manufacturing, and aerospace, where insulation needs are more demanding.
Beyond heat resistance, Zirconia fiber's unique properties make it highly effective in reducing energy loss and improving process efficiency. The fibers are lightweight, which helps to minimize the overall structural load and simplify installation. Moreover, the material’s low thermal conductivity ensures minimal heat transfer, thus enhancing the energy efficiency of industrial equipment and reducing operating costs. The Zirconia Fiber Products subsegment includes a range of specialized products made from zirconia fibers. These products include mats, blankets, boards, and pre-formed shapes, which are designed for specific applications requiring enhanced heat resistance, thermal stability, and durability. Zirconia fiber products are ideal for use in environments with extreme temperatures, such as those found in aerospace, automotive, and industrial processing sectors. The flexibility of zirconia fiber allows it to be manufactured into various forms, catering to a wide array of industrial needs.
One of the most prominent uses of Zirconia Fiber Products is in the aerospace industry, where high-performance insulation materials are critical for engines, turbines, and thermal protection systems. These products can withstand the harsh conditions of high-speed flights and space exploration, offering both thermal insulation and resistance to mechanical stresses. Additionally, zirconia fibers are used in automotive applications, particularly for insulating exhaust systems and high-temperature components in electric vehicles.
